Differentiating Structural from Cosmetic Damage in Model Y
When it comes to Model Y body damage repair, distinguishing between structural and cosmetic issues is paramount for effective restoration. Structural damage refers to any harm that compromises the vehicle’s safety and integrity, such as frame cracks or misaligned panels affecting stability. In contrast, cosmetic damage involves less critical aesthetics-related problems like dents, scratches, or minor paint chips that don’t impact the car’s overall structural soundness.
Proper diagnosis is key in Model Y body damage repair. Professionals employ advanced diagnostic tools and expertise to differentiate between these two types of damage. Accurate identification ensures tailored repairs, with cosmetic issues often addressed through meticulous detailing and painting, while structural repairs may involve complex processes like metal welding or frame straightening, reminiscent of Mercedes-Benz repair standards, to restore the vehicle’s safety and performance. Choosing the right car bodywork services for each type of damage is essential for a safe and reliable Model Y.
Repair Process for Model Y Structural Body Damage
The process of repairing structural body damage on a Model Y involves a meticulous and precise approach to ensure the vehicle’s safety and structural integrity. It begins with a thorough inspection to identify the extent of the damage, which can range from dents and dings to more severe crashes. Skilled technicians use advanced tools and techniques for each unique case, including specialized equipment for metal welding, straightening, and alignment. This phase demands expertise in materials science and engineering to match the original factory specifications accurately.
Once the structure is restored, a multi-step process ensures the vehicle’s aesthetic appeal. It involves meticulous painting, panel replacement if necessary, and meticulous detail work. The goal is not just to make it look good but to ensure it retains its structural soundness, which is vital for the safety of the driver and passengers. Restoring Cosmetic Imperfections: Techniques and Considerations
Restoring Cosmetic Imperfections involves techniques that cater specifically to Model Y’s sleek and modern design. This often includes meticulous paintless dent repair for minor dents, scratches, or dings on the car’s exterior panels. For more visible imperfections like chips or cracks in the bumper or trim, skilled technicians employ advanced filling and sanding methods to match the original factory finish perfectly.
Considerations during this process are vast; achieving a seamless blend between repaired areas and untouched surfaces is paramount to preserve the Model Y’s aesthetic appeal. The use of high-quality paints and specialized tools ensures that repairs are not only invisible to the naked eye but also withstand the test of time, maintaining the vehicle’s overall value and appearance in line with its original condition.
